Sunbrella undergoes brand identity update

Published On: January 1, 2009Categories: Industry News

The performance fabric brand Sunbrella underwent a brand identity update, including a new logo, to acknowledge its 50-year heritage, while focusing on innovation and enhanced styling for today’s consumers.

Sunbrella’s yellow, red and blue umbrella has morphed into a stylized, deep orange umbrella. The type face has been updated with a cleaner, more contemporary look.

“When the previous logo was introduced, Sunbrella fabrics were primarily solid colors and broad stripes,” said Hal Hunnicutt, vice president of marketing for Glen Raven Custom Fabrics. “Sunbrella has progressed dramatically during the past decade. We wanted to retain elements of the brand that people are so familiar with and trust, yet give the identity a refresh that better reflects where Sunbrella is today and where it’s headed for the future.”

The new brand identity will be phased into various marketing elements over the next several months, including advertising, web, packaging and collateral materials.
